James A. Michener Quotes
The History Of A Daughter Is A Drama In Three Acts. One: From Age Three To Nineteen You Will Kill Any Man Who Touches Her. Two: From Age Twenty To Twenty-five You Hope That One At Least Of The Young Men Nosing Around Will Prove Satisfactory. Three: From Age Twenty-six On You Pray That Any Man At All, Even A Train Robber, Will Take Her Off Your Hands. Marjorie Is Twenty-three And My Husband No Longer Dreams Of A Perfect Husband. Just An Acceptable One.
